About

Professor Yacoub Khalaf is a Consultant Gynaecologist with renowned expertise in assisted conception, infertility, recurrent miscarriage, PCOS and the management of fibroids. He obtained his medical degree at Assiut University, Egypt and moved to the UK to complete his subspecialty training in Reproductive Medicine and Surgery at Guy's and St Thomas' Hospital in London. He later completed a MD in Birmingham and was appointed as a Consultant Gynaecologist in 2001 at Guy's and St Thomas' NHS Foundation Trust.

Mr Khalaf is an internationally recognised expert in the assisted conception and the management of infertility. He currently holds the position of Medical Director of the Assisted Conception Unit at his NHS Trust and is the Director of the Pre-implantation Genetic Diagnosis Programme. Through these roles, Mr Khalaf and his team has helped numerous couples fulfil their dream of having children.

Mr Khalaf also has specialist interest and expertise in the conservative management of uterine fibroids. He is dedicated to his practice and prides himself in providing truly patient-focused care to each individual in his care.

He has lectured at both national and international conferences and meetings and has published his work widely. He has appeared in the media, including on ITV and Channel 4 and has been interviewed by BBC Today and Radio 5. In addition to this, Mr Khalaf is a spokesperson for the British Fertility Society.
